When it comes to leasing a property in Hennepin County, a sample letter for a lease agreement can be helpful in ensuring a smooth and legally binding transaction. A general property lease letter outlines the terms and conditions of the lease agreement between the landlord and the tenant. There are different types of Hennepin Minnesota Sample Letters for Lease — General Property, depending on the specific property and lease agreement. Some common types include: 1. Residential Lease Letter: This type of lease letter is used for leasing residential properties such as apartments, houses, or condos in Hennepin County. It includes details about the duration of the lease, rent amount, security deposit, maintenance responsibilities, and other provisions. 2. Commercial Lease Letter: For those looking to lease commercial properties like offices, retail spaces, or warehouses in Hennepin County, a commercial lease letter is appropriate. It may include specific terms related to zoning regulations, permitted use of the property, signage, rent escalations, and other commercial lease considerations. 3. Vacation Rental Lease Letter: Hennepin County is a popular tourist destination, and many property owners choose to lease their homes or cabins as vacation rentals. A vacation rental lease letter outlines the terms and conditions for short-term stays, including rental duration, occupancy limits, house rules, and payment details. 4. Agricultural Lease Letter: Hennepin County also has a significant agricultural presence with farms and rural properties. An agricultural lease letter is relevant for leasing agricultural land or farm buildings and includes provisions for crop or livestock production, maintenance of the property, lease duration, and other agricultural-specific terms. In summary, when seeking to lease a property in Hennepin County, Minnesota, there are different types of sample letters for lease agreements, including residential, commercial, vacation rental, and agricultural leases. These letters ensure clear communication of the terms and conditions between the landlord and tenant, facilitating a successful leasing experience.

Regardless of whether you decide to use a lease or a rental agreement, you'll want to address the following topics: Names of All Tenants and Occupants.Description of Rental Property.Term of the Tenancy.Rental Price.Security Deposits and Fees.Repair and Maintenance Policies.Landlord's Right to Enter Rental Property.
